Let us consider a copper wire having radius r and length l. Let its resistance be R. If the radius of another copper wire is 2r and the length is $$\frac{l}{2}$$, then the resistance of this wire will be
A. R
B. 2R
C. $$\frac{R}{4}$$
D. $$\frac{R}{8}$$
Answer: Option D
